Universal Holy Book is a contemplative spiritual work that explores the idea that divine wisdom is not confined to ancient scripture but continues to live through human experience.
Through reflective teachings, philosophical insights, and poetic meditations, the book presents the concept that every human being can act as a living verse in a sacred and unfolding text . Drawing inspiration from spiritual traditions, nature, and the universal search for meaning, the author invites readers to view everyday life as a form of sacred revelation.
Each chapter explores themes such as:
Listening as a sacred act
The interconnectedness of human experience
The spiritual lessons within nature
The role of failure, redemption, and renewal
The presence of divine wisdom in ordinary life
Rather than presenting rigid doctrine, Universal Holy Book encourages readers to develop deeper awareness, compassion, and reflection in their own lives. The work blends philosophy, spirituality, and introspection to create a universal message that transcends religious boundaries.
